Based on 140 recent sales, the median property price is £268,000 (about £326 per square foot) in Weston-super-Mare South Worle area, with individual transactions ranging from £115,000 up to £685,000.
| Type | Sales | Median | £/sq ft |
|---|---|---|---|
| Detached | 35 | £330,000 | £335 |
| Semi-Detached | 55 | £271,000 | £327 |
| Terraced | 45 | £241,000 | £316 |
| Flats | 5 | £155,000 | £261 |

Postcode BS22 6SD is located in an urban city, within the Weston-super-Mare South Worle ward of North Somerset in the South West region, and forms part of the Mid Worle area. It has average deprivation and very low crime levels, with around 29.2 crimes per 1,000 residents per year, about 66% below the South West average of 85 per 1,000. The average income per household in Mid Worle is £45,271 per year. The nearest station is Worle, about 0.5 miles away. There are 8 primary and 2 secondary schools in the area. There is 1 park nearby, the closest small park is Living Sculpture Park.
Mid Worle has an average level of deprivation, ranked at position 15,258 out of 32,844 areas in England, placing it within the top 46% most deprived areas in England.
Mid Worle has a very low crime rate, with approximately 29.2 reported incidents per 1,000 population each year.
Approximately 1.0% of homes on this street are social housing provided by a local council or housing association. Across the surrounding area, around 11.0% of dwellings are socially rented.
The average income per household in Mid Worle is £45,271 per year.
No significant noise sources from railways or roads near BS22 6SD.
Mid Worle near BS22 6SD has very low flood risk (less than 0.1% chance of a flood each year) from rivers and sea.
